| Nudists Posted: 5/27/2007 11:45:25 AM | I think the older you get, the more comfortable you are with social nudity. On the other hand, maybe some of us are just born naked and want to stay that way!
Frankly, I've always been one to want to be barefoot...and in as few clothes as possible, temperature permitting. Less is more! (more comfort, more freedom)
I do my share of 'clothing optional' activities - from my own home and back yard to local naturist gathering spots. Swimming and sunning in the nude...feels great! The only thing that bothers me is the high cost of joining AANR!
As for kids, I never was prudish around mine as they grew up (boys) and now that they're grown, although they aren't nudists, they have healthy attitudes toward nudity and don't have unrealistic expectations of female nudity (that is to say, they don't expect every woman to look like a Playmate of the Month with their clothes off). I did stay appropriately clothed, by and large (nighttime TV time was my time for nothing more than a tee shirt and panties), but if they walked in while I was in the shower or dressing, I didn't hustle them out of the room or reach for a robe to 'cover up'.
Anyway, that's just a few thoughts from someone who's been there, done that and enjoys it! | |
